ASME B16.48 Ring Spacer | Paddle Spacer | Female RTJ

Technical Drawing The female ring-joint groove on the open end of the paddle spacer shall be cut in accordance with ASME B16.5. A single through indicator hole shall be drilled near the end of the handle. Usually, the hole diameter is 3/4″. Pressure-Temperature Ratings for ASTM A350 LF2 Flanges

Pipe flanges made from ASTM A350 Gr. LF2 steel are usually manufactured in accordance with ASME B16.5 or ASME B16.47. It is a typical Group 1.1 material. The pressure-temperature ratings for ASTM A350 LF2 indicate maximum allowable working pressures in bar or psi units at the temperatures in °C or °F units. ASME B16.48 Figure-8 Blank | Spectacle Blind | Female RTJ

Technical Drawing The female ring-joint groove dimensions shall be in accordance with ASME B16.5. Size of the hole on the tie bar (where required due to bolt spacing) shall be the same as the flange bolt hole and located such that it will not interfere with bolting between two flanges. Carbon Steel Forgings: A105 vs. A105N

Carbon steel forgings, manufactured in accordance with ASTM A105, are generally used for piping applications. These forged carbon steel piping components (including flanges, fittings, and valves, etc) are used for ambient- and higher-temperature service in pressure systems. Can ASTM A105 Forgings Be Used for Tubesheets?

ASTM A105/ A105M, identical with ASME SA-105/ SA-105M, is the standard specification for carbon steel forgings for piping applications. The application of ASME SA-105 forgings is endorsed by a series of ASME Boiler and Pressure Vessel Codes and ASME B31 Codes.
